So, how do you find a reliable walk-in optometrist in Rockford? First, it's important to clarify terminology. Many practices offer "same-day" or "urgent care" appointments rather than a true first-come, first-served walk-in model. Your best strategy is to call local optometry offices directly, especially later in the morning when same-day cancellation slots may open up. Explain your symptoms clearly; issues like sudden vision loss, severe pain, or flashes of light are typically prioritized. Be prepared with your vision insurance information, but also know that many clinics will see you for an urgent visit even if you are not an established patient.
For non-emergencies like prescription updates or frame adjustments, some larger optical retailers in the Rockford area may accommodate walk-ins based on technician availability. However, for medical eye concerns, seeking a licensed optometrist is always recommended.
